UP Assembly Speaker Criticises SP MP Awadhesh Prasad Over Ram Mandir Comments

The Uttar Pradesh Assembly Speaker, Satish Mahana, has sharply criticised Samajwadi Party MP Awadhesh Prasad for remarks regarding alleged theft of donations at the Ram Temple in Ayodhya. Mahana contends that Prasad’s statements are insulting to the Hindu community and reflect poorly on his character. He specifically mentioned that such remarks indicate a broader accusation against all Hindus, which he deemed unacceptable.

Mahana articulated his concerns in a press interaction, suggesting that Prasad’s comments not only damaged public sentiment but also displayed a lack of respect for those devoted to Lord Ram. He questioned how individuals disconnected from the religious context could demand accountability for donations made by devotees. This, he asserted, was a grievous reproach against the entire Hindu community.

Furthermore, Mahana accused Prasad of attempting to politicise a sensitive issue that affects devotees’ faith and trust in the temple’s management. He emphasized the need for constructive dialogue rather than incendiary remarks that could deepen societal divides.

Samajwadi Party MP’s Controversial Statement

The controversy originated from Awadhesh Prasad’s assertions concerning transparency in the handling of donations at the Ram Temple. Earlier, he had demanded that receipts be provided to devotees contributing to the temple, alongside calls for better accountability regarding the usage of those funds. His remarks stirred significant backlash from various political figures.

Prasad’s comment that “if Muslims had been present there, the theft would not have happened” incited immediate condemnation from the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P). Critics within the BJP labelled his statement as objectionable and communal, arguing that it demeaned Hindu devotees by linking an alleged theft directly to their faith.

Following the uproar over Prasad’s statement, multiple BJP leaders expressed their discontent, suggesting that his comments had not only offended Hindu sentiments but also undermined the integrity of the community at large. The BJP has positioned itself as a defender of Hindu interests in this discourse, asserting that Prasad’s comments merit scrutiny beyond the context of the alleged theft.

Political Ramifications and Broader Implications

This exchange signals an intensified political rivalry between the Bharatiya Janata Party and the Samajwadi Party in Uttar Pradesh, particularly regarding issues related to the Ram Temple. Both parties have accused each other of exploiting the topic for political gain, further complicating an already volatile political landscape.

The Ram Temple has been a pivotal issue in Indian politics, especially since its consecration, with discussions about its administration and funding often leading to contentious debates. This event has underscored the heightened sensitivity surrounding the temple, reflecting its profound political and religious significance for many in India.

As the situation develops, it remains to be seen how parties will navigate the complexities surrounding the Ram Temple and its associated narratives. The latest remarks from both sides highlight ongoing demands for transparency and accountability in temple management, amidst concerns over how political rhetoric influences communal relations.
